Donna Young Obituary

Young, Sgt. Donna J. Sgt. Donna J. Young, retired CPD, (nee Hockenberry), cherished mother of Rhonda (the late Keith) Mulac, Sherri (Louie Molenda) Noto, Lawrence Young and Sgt. Ray (Sue) Young, loving daugher of Mary Hockenberry, dear companion of Fred Biddle, beloved grandmother of Cyndi, Jessa, Joey, Jackie, Will and Grayson, fond great-grandmother of Angelina and Savannah, dear sister of James Hockenberry, Candice (George) Beaubien, Beckie (Bernie) Kreppel, Deborah (Gordon) Beaubien and John Francis Hockenberry, fond aunt of many nieces and nephews, loving mommy to Taz and Kady. Resting at the Cumberland Chapels, 8300 W. Lawrence, Norridge, where visitaion will be held Friday, from 3 p.m. until time of service 8:30 p.m. Buriel private. In lieu of flowers donations to the American Cancer Society appreciated. Donna was one of the first female Chicago Police officers and she was the first female canine officers. 708-456-8300
